Reducing the risk of Disaster through Promotion of Rights and Good Governance
In three disaster prone regions of Bangladesh, BDPC is working with vulnerable house holds, civil society members and local government agencies to ensure that individuals understand their service entitlements and the relevant agencies are effectively providing those services.

Disaster risk reduction and climate change fortified livelihoods through good governance
BDPC is using an integrated approach to help coastal house holds adapt to the impacts of climate change. This includes developing and implementing local risk reduction action plans, providing climate compatible livelihood opportunities and establishing good governance.

Shelter based community risk reduction
BDPC is working with the Swiss Agency for Development and Cooperation (SDC) to provide community managed cyclone shelters for Sidr affected communities in Morrelganj, on the south coast of Bangladesh.
